How to Identify the Dell Threat Defense Version

Summary: The version of Dell Threat Defense may be identified by following these instructions.

This article applies to   This article does not apply to 

Symptoms

Note:

It is important to know the Dell Threat Defense version to:

  • Identify known issues.
  • Determine UI differences.
  • Understand workflow changes.
  • Verify system requirements.

Affected Products:

Dell Threat Defense

Affected Operating Systems:

Windows
Mac


Cause

Not applicable.

Resolution

Click the appropriate operating system tab for versioning information.

Versioning can be determined either through the product's:

  • User interface (UI)
  • Installer
Click the appropriate method for more information.
UI
Note: Dell Threat Defense must be installed before identifying the version through the UI. For more information, reference How to Install Dell Threat Defense.

To identify the version using the UI:

  1. Expand the Windows system tray by clicking the up arrow.

Windows System Tray

  1. Right-click the Dell Threat Defense icon and then select About.

About

  1. Document the Version.

Version

Note:
  • The most important number is the third number. In the example, the third number is 1372.
  • The Version in the example may differ in your environment.
Note: For information about downloading the installer, reference, How to Download Dell Threat Defense.

To identify the version using the Installer:

  1. Right-click DellThreatDefenseSetup.exe and then select Properties.

Properties

  1. Click the Details tab.

Details

  1. Document the Product Version.

Product version

Note:
  • The most important number is the third number. In the example, the third number is 1442.
  • The Product Version in the example may differ in your environment.

Versioning can be determined either through the product's:

  • User Interface (UI)
  • Installer
Click the appropriate method for more information.
UI
Note: Dell Threat Defense must be installed before identifying the version through the UI. For more information, reference How to Install Dell Threat Defense.

To identify the version using the UI:

  1. In the Status Menu (at the top of the screen), right-click the Dell Threat Defense icon and then select About.

About

  1. Document the Version.

Version

Note:
  • The most important number is the third number. In the example, the third number is 1382.
  • The Version in the example may differ in your environment.
Note: For information about downloading the installer, reference How to Download Dell Threat Defense.

To identify the version using the Installer:

  1. Right-click DellThreatDefenseSetup.dmg and then select Get Info.

Get Info

  1. Expand More Info and then document the product version.

Version

Note:
  • The most important number is the third number. In the example, the third number is 1452.
  • The version in the example may differ in your environment.
